But what if one of the strongest predictors of how long and how well you live is something we rarely prioritize: the quality of your relationships? Today on The Dhru Purohit Show, Dhru sits down with Keith Ferrazzi to explore why meaningful relationships may be one of the most overlooked pillars of health and longevity. Keith shares the science behind connection, why accountability is one of the biggest predictors of success, and how surrounding yourself with the right people can transform your health, career, and happiness. He also explains the surprising power of generosity, creating a shared vision, and building a community that helps everyone grow together. Keith Ferrazzi is the founder and CEO of Ferrazzi Greenlight, a New York Times bestselling author, and a globally recognized expert on leadership and team performance.
